Web8 Apr 2024 · Use the elevation marked on index lines to calculate the elevation of interval lines. On a map with a 40-foot contour interval, the interval line to the inside of the index line would be at 6,540 feet above sea level. Web13 Sep 2011 · A spur is a subsidiary summit of a mountain. Web29 Mar 2024 · Both gullies and spurs run from ridgelines to valley bottoms. Gullies (or draws) are characterized by “U” or “V” shaped contour lines with their closed-end pointing towards higher elevation. On the other hand, …

A spur is a lateral ridge or tongue of land descending from a hill, mountain or main crest of a ridge .
